Join us for this online dialogue which focuses on using design thinking to find innovative approaches to understand ECCE scenario in India. It would aim to:

  • To brainstorm for an effective ECCE ecosystem
  • To understand the current scenario in the country and missing gaps
  • Discuss the role of the ECCE United Network

The dialogue will be held in a 3-part series mode. The first part is taking place on 30th March, 2020.

SPEAKERS

Dr. Rekha Sharma Sen is Professor in Child Development at Indira Gandhi National Open University, New Delhi. She was Chair Professor (on deputation) at Centre for Early Childhood Development and Research (CECDR), Jamia Millia Islamia in the period July 2011-May 2014. Her specialization and areas of interest include Early Childhood Care and Education, Disability, Creativity, Emergent and Early Literacy, and Gender in Open and Distance Learning.

At IGNOU she has developed programmes of study in the sector of Early Childhood Care and Education and Disability. At Jamia Millia Islamia she taught post graduate course and conducted research, including evaluation of implementation of restructured ICDS curriculum developed by the states in the period 2012-14.

She has been member of committees of Ministry of Women and Child Development, Government of India and National Council for Teacher Education for ECCE policy, preschool curriculum norms and syllabus. She is member of the Steering Committee of a voluntary association of academics and practitioners in ECD called the ‘Alliance for the Right to Early Childhood Development’. She has provided technical academic support and consultancy to institutions such as NCERT, NIPCCD, UNICEF, Azim Premji University, University of Delhi and Mobile Crèches. She has authored research-based articles and chapters for refereed journals and books and authored chapters for NCERT senior secondary textbooks.

Dr. Vrinda Datta is currently the Director of Center for Early Childhood Education and Development (CECED) at Ambedkar University Delhi. She has carried out projects funded by UNICEF, World Bank, WHO, Govt. of Maharashtra, MHRD and NGOs like CASP-PLAN, Mobile Creches. Till 2015, she was Professor at the School of Human Ecology, Tata Institute of Social Sciences, Mumbai. With a PhD in Human Development, she has been a keen researcher in the field of early childhood.

The areas of her work have been, issues of quality in early childhood programs, teacher training, and impact of early childhood programs on children’s development. This has given scope to have many publications to her credit. She is also the president of the Association for Early Childhood Education and Development (AECED) which is a national network of institutions and individuals working for the young child. In 2005, she was selected as a Global Leader from India by the World forum Foundation and in 2007 became the recipient of Senior Fulbright Research Fellowship to Brandeis University,USA.
